Stevermer, Caroline. A scholar of magics.


STEVERMER, Caroline. A scholar of magics. (Sequel to A College of Magics.)Tor. 419p. c2004.0-765-35346-6. $5.99. SA

 meets a Wild West Harry Potter, Sam Lambert, an American sharpshooter from Kiowa Bob's Wild West Show, is recruited by the Glasscastle University in England to help with a top-secret magic project. Sam becomes acquainted with the provost's sister, who teaches magic at a sister college. Her name is Jane Brailsford (not Jane Eyre). They become enamored en·am·or

 Rochester). They take off on an indecorous cross-country automobile adventure ending with Jane held captive by the evil don and Sam having to save not only her, but all the other college personnel, who were changed into various animals.

Harry Potter fans with a penchant for Victorian melodrama will love this. Although the magical contexts and powerful ending are superb, to me, it would have been a better adventure without the references to her hat veil or her gloves. The angst-driven characters and titillating tit·il·late
